However, it’s important to note that exposing. Drying takes a matter of minutes when you use spray cans, because the solvents are volatile and evaporate quickly. In general, spray paint can dry in the sun within a few minutes to an hour or so, depending on the specific paint and the conditions. However, it can take up to 24 hours for the paint to fully cure.
